Badshot Lea crashed to an emphatic 4-0 defeat at home to Leatherhead in the Isthmian League South Central Division.
Goals from Ruben Bartlett-Antwi, George Hedley, Kareem Akinnibi and Matthew Everitt gave the Tanners the three points in front of a crowd of 321 at Westfield Lane.
The visitors were quick out of the traps and took the lead in the first minute when Bartlett-Antwi fired an excellent right-foot volley into the right-hand corner of the net past Baggies keeper Harry Cawdron.
The Tanners nearly doubled their lead five minutes later when Bartlett-Antwi’s header from a corner went just over the bar.
Bartlett-Antwi continued to be a threat and his shot in the ninth minute was well blocked by Baggies centre-back George Winkworth.
Leatherhead scored their second of the afternoon from the resulting corner when former Baggie Kane Fitzgerald’s delivery found Hedley – another former Baggie – at the back post and Hedley headed home past Cawdron into the bottom right-hand corner of the net.
The Baggies had their first effort of the afternoon on 15 minutes when Luis Le Paih’s left-foot shot from just outside the box went wide of the right-hand post.
The visitors continued to look dangerous going forward and they nearly went 3-0 up in the 24th minute when Hedley’s header forced an excellent diving save from Cawdron.
Leatherhead did score their third three minutes later when a quick counter-attack ended with Bartlett-Antwi clipping a ball over the top to former Baggie Akinnibi, who calmly lifted his finish over the onrushing Cawdron and into the empty net.
The Baggies nearly pulled a goal back on 42 minutes when Luke Jarvie’s corner found Le Paih, but his header went wide of the right-hand post.
Leatherhead then almost scored a fourth before half-time when Fitzgerald’s cross found the unmarked Akinnibi in the box, but he put his header over the bar.
The Tanners continued to create chances after the break and substitute Rhys Murrell-Williams’ powerful left-foot shot from distance on 54 minutes was well parried behind for a corner by Cawdron.
Badshot Lea nearly pulled a goal back in the 71st minute when substitute Dawid Hamiga drove forward from midfield and hit a decent right-foot shot just wide of the left-hand post.
The Baggies went close again on 80 minutes when Hamiga’s corner found the unmarked Callum Wiltshire at the near post, who flicked his effort over the bar.
The hosts had another decent chances four minutes later when Steven Sylla’s shot was well blocked by Cameron Black.
The Tanners scored their fourth of the afternoon in stoppage time when Everitt calmly placed his finish past Cawdron.
Next up for the Baggies is a trip to Combined Counties Premier Division South outfit Tadley Calleva in the Aldershot Senior Cup on Tuesday, March 25 (7.45pm kick-off).
